I dont think they were actual machine gun action Steve...
I saw several of them "tuning" their guns... apparently the trigger is actually a rocker switch.. so by rocking it back and forth they can achieve a high rate of fire...
So while our group was out doing battle you would hear pop.... pop pop.. pop pop pop pop..pop....pop pop..... from the other group it sounded more like 4 or 5 machine guns going off simultaneously... and of course one of the results of this was that their battles only lasted about a minuit and a half.. no survivors! :huh:

Yeah there was a serious arms race going on as the sport became popular in the late '80's and early 90's. Long barrels for range, 7oz tanks, high capacity gravity fed hoppers and so on, each one having a radical effect on game tactics. I'll bet it's a totally different game with the stuff they have nowadays.

Anybody got any recomandations on equipment?
Yeah. Stay away from Brass Eagle stuff if you can help it. I would also recommend the Spyder Sonix as a good, affordable, weapon, but evidently it doesn't survive the pressure changes in airplanes too well. When I got home, I disassembled mine and found 2 dislodged gaskets.:shifty:
The most important thing is to find a marker that is comfortable for you to shoot, and has an acceptable rate of fire (between 5 and 15 balls per second) You might want to stay away from full-autos since many fields do not allow them. A barrel-squeegee (barrel cleaner) is also a good piece of gear to have, and you'll want to invest in some fog-suppressant lens spray for your mask. A motorized hopper is nice, and almost necessary for some of the faster guns.
